The Benefits of Laser Technology in Oral Health Treatment
Laser dentistry offers a range of benefits that make it an advanced and preferred choice for oral health treatment. One of its key advantages is precision; lasers allow dentists to perform procedures with incredible accuracy, reducing the risk of damage to surrounding tissues. This technology can be particularly useful in tasks such as tooth shaping, gum reshaping, and even teeth whitening.
Another advantage is minimal discomfort and faster healing times. Unlike traditional dental tools that may cause some pain or require lengthy recovery periods, laser dentistry often provides a more comfortable experience for patients. Lasers can also help reduce the overall time spent in the chair, making dental care more efficient and convenient for both patients and dentists.
Common Procedures Using Laser Dentistry Techniques
Laser dentistry is transforming dental care with its advanced techniques and precise capabilities. One of the most common procedures utilizing this technology is tooth decay treatment. Lasers can accurately remove decayed portions of a tooth, minimizing the need for drilling and filling. This not only preserves more of the natural tooth structure but also offers a more comfortable experience for patients.
Another popular application is periodontal (gum) disease treatment. Laser dentistry can effectively cleanse and decontaminate gum pockets, eliminating bacteria and promoting healing. This method reduces inflammation, aids in regenerating gum tissue, and may even help in bone regrowth, providing a more comprehensive approach to periodontal care compared to traditional methods.
Safety and Precision: How Lasers Enhance Dental Work
Laser dentistry offers a new era in dental care, combining precision and safety like never before. Lasers allow dentists to perform various procedures with exceptional accuracy, minimizing the need for invasive techniques. This advanced technology utilizes concentrated light beams to cut or shape tissues, offering a sterile and bloodless environment that enhances comfort for patients.
One of the significant advantages is the reduced risk of infection. Unlike traditional dental tools, lasers create a sterile field as they work, significantly lowering the chances of introducing bacteria. Moreover, laser dentistry allows for more precise drilling and cutting, which means less tissue damage and faster healing times for patients.
